Identification the Causes of Negative Emotions in Smart Public Transportation Services Based on Social Media Data

摘要

The negative emotional comments of smart public transportation maybe contain specific reasons behind them. If the underlying reasons can be identified, it is beneficial to timely improve public transportation (PT) services and provide a more comfortable PT experience for the public. However, the application of emotional analysis based on social media in bus service evaluation is limited, especially in the exploration of the reasons behind negative evaluations of bus services, which is still in a blank stage. Therefore, based on social media data, the paper studies the method of identifying the causes of negative emotions in PT services. Sentiment data is obtained through Sina microlog. The reasons for negative emotions are proposed and classified, which are divided into seven types: long waiting times, poor hygiene, poor driver attitude, unstable driving, overcrowding, unreasonable pricing, and other reasons. Then, a classification model for negative emotions based on feature fusion and attention mechanism, BERT-BiGRU + CNN-Attention model, is established to identify the causes of various negative emotions. Finally, the proposed method is used for analysis and validation. This model incorporates an attention model on the basis of feature fusion, which assigns higher weights to important features. Therefore, the F1 value classified on the test set reached 0.9724, achieving a good identification result.
